  1. In the event a bank commitment letter specifies a 75% Loan-to-Value ratio for a $1,000,000 project, which subsequently appraises for $960,000, what will the bank ultimately loan on the project?
    1. $750,000
    2. $960,000
    3. $720,000
    4. $830,000

Answer #1

LTV Ratio = Amount Borrowed / Appraised Value

0.75 = Amount Borrowed / $960,000

Amount Borrowed = 0.75 * $960,000 = $720,000

Hence, Option "c" is correct.
